We are seeking a motivated postdoctoral research scholar for a one-year position (with potential for an additional one-year extension) under the joint supervision of USDA Agricultural Research Service scientists Dr. Danielle Lemay and Dr. Deb Peters. The postdoc will be part of the SCINet Postdoctoral program and will be located in Davis, CA (USDA-ARS Western Human Nutrition Research Center). The postdoc will use machine learning approaches to predict the effects of diet on various health outcomes from a healthy California population. The postdoc will also be responsible for developing standardized machine learning workflows for nutrition research and will develop and co-lead ARS-wide workshops resulting in a community of scientific practice for applying machine learning to nutrition data.

Requirements:

  • Recent PhD (within the last 4 years) in a biological science, computer science, statistics, or other related field
  • Interest in nutrition and human health
  • Demonstrated ability to conduct effective oral communication and publication of manuscripts in peer-reviewed scientific journals
  • U.S. Citizen or permanent resident

Additional Preferences:

  • Proficiency in R and/or Python
  • Experience using software version control systems (e.g. git)
  • Experience with high performance computing environments with SLURM submission scheduling
  • Skill in the facilitation of meetings and working with multi-disciplinary groups
